Britain's Best Brain

Season 12009

Britain's Best Brain is a television programme running in the United Kingdom on Channel 5 and saw ordinary members of the public undertake various tasks, all scientifically designed to test different parts of the brain. The show ran every Wednesday and was aired from 28 October to 16 December 2009. The winner, crowned 'Britain's Best Brain 2009', was Matt Clancy, a 29 year-old marketing consultant from London. The show was hosted by former Live & Kicking presenters Jamie Theakston and ZoΓ« Ball. A free to play browser game was launched on 3 October 2009 and was commissioned by Tiger Aspect Productions and developed by Fish in a bottle.
